According to , there are 6,148,617 people in Missouri. Missouri's current debt is $4.478*10¹⁰. What is the state debt per Missouri citizen?

Step-by-step explanation:

To calculate the state debt per Missouri citizen, we divide the total state debt by the population of Missouri. With a state debt of $44.78 billion ($4.478 \times 10^{10}) and a population of 6,148,617 people, the calculation would be:

State Debt Per Citizen = Total State Debt / Population
= $44,780,000,000 / 6,148,617
= approximately $7,282.35 per citizen

Thus, each Missouri citizen would have to pay approximately $7,282.35 to eliminate the state's debt.
